Start with Licensing and Player Protection
A legitimate UK-facing casino should clearly identify its operating company, licence information and responsible gambling tools. In Britain, licensing by the UK Gambling Commission is a key indicator that the operator must follow rules covering customer funds, advertising, identity checks and safer gambling procedures.
Look for transparent ownership details, accessible customer support and clear policies for complaints. A trustworthy casino does not hide restrictions in confusing wording or make withdrawal requirements difficult to locate. Players should also be able to set deposit limits, take a time-out or close an account without unnecessary pressure.
- Check the licence reference through the regulator’s official register.
- Confirm that the casino accepts players from your location.
- Review age verification and know-your-customer requirements.
- Find responsible gambling controls before making a deposit.
- Read the privacy policy and information about fund security.
Compare Bonuses by Real Value
Promotional packages can improve entertainment value, but headline figures often conceal important conditions. A deposit match may include a maximum eligible deposit, a wagering multiplier, restricted games and a short expiry period. Free spins may apply only to selected slots, while winnings can be capped.
| Bonus detail | Why it matters | What to check |
|---|---|---|
| Wagering requirement | Determines how much qualifying play is needed | Multiplier, contribution rules and deadline |
| Maximum bonus | Limits the promotional amount | Eligible deposit and maximum conversion |
| Game restrictions | Controls which titles count fully | Slot contribution and excluded games |
| Withdrawal rules | May affect bonus and related winnings | Verification, caps and permitted methods |
Compare the expected value rather than the advertised percentage. A smaller offer with moderate wagering and flexible game eligibility may be more practical than a larger promotion with severe restrictions. Never deposit more than you can afford simply to unlock a bonus.
Assess Games, Software and Fairness
A strong casino combines a broad catalogue with dependable software providers. Established studios usually publish information about random number generation, return-to-player percentages and game rules. These details do not guarantee profit, but they help players understand the mathematical structure of each title.
Slots differ in volatility, hit frequency and maximum win potential. Table games have their own house advantages, while live dealer products depend on streaming quality, limits and table availability. Review the paytable before playing and use demo modes where available. A polished design should support informed decisions, not distract from them.
Examine Payments and Withdrawals
Payment performance is one of the clearest tests of an online casino’s reliability. Before depositing, inspect supported cards, e-wallets and bank transfer options, along with minimum deposits, fees and processing times. The same method may not be available for withdrawals, so confirm the full transaction route in advance.
Identity checks are normal, particularly before a first withdrawal. Prepare valid documents and ensure that your account details match your payment information. Delays become more concerning when support gives vague answers, repeatedly requests unnecessary documents or changes the terms after a winning session.
- Use a payment method registered in your own name.
- Check withdrawal limits and processing windows.
- Keep confirmation emails and transaction records.
- Ask support about pending payments before escalating a dispute.
